The rapid display of related still images is the basis of which animation principle?

Explanation:
Persistence of vision explains why showing a rapid sequence of related still images appears as smooth motion. The eye retains a brief afterimage, so each picture blends with the next when shown quickly, creating the illusion of continuous movement—this is the fundamental reason traditional animation and film work. Motion blur describes a streaking effect from exposure time, not the perceptual basis for motion from stills. Frame interpolation is a digital method to add frames between originals, and onion skinning is a drawing aid to view multiple frames simultaneously; neither describes how we perceive rapid image sequences as motion.
